DENIZEN from Levi Strauss

Levi Strauss & Co., U.S. Jeans maker launched a new low priced global Levis brand aimed at the Asia, specifically China. The new brand of jean is called the "dENIZEN" is aimed at young consumers.

Trivia:-
dENIZEN is the first brand in the company's long history to make a global debut in Asia, and to be launched outside the U.S. dENiZEN, the brand name, means "inhabitant" and echoes of the words denim, citizen and netizen.

Bytes:-
Levi Strauss was founded in 1853 by a German-Jewish immigrant to the U.S. On May 20, 1873, the company received U.S. Patent No.139,121 for the process of putting rivets in pants for strength. The two-horse brand design was first used in 1886, and the red tab attached to the left rear pocket was created in 1936.

KidsCo going to make India debut with NDTV

KidsCo, an international children's entertainment brand roped with NDTV India to make an entry into India's broadcasting space. Under the distribution agreement, NDTV will market the content of KidsCo on all the three DTH, Cable TV and Digital Platforms across the country.

KidsCo was founded by Canadian broadcaster Corus Entertainment's Nelvana Enterprises, America based producer DIC Entertainment and European broadcaster Sparrowhawk Media Group in April 2007. The channel’s main network is currently based in London.

Maaza Milky Delite - Sharing not possible


Coca-Cola India forayed into the dairy segment through milk-based beverage, Maaza Milky Delite which is a blend of mango pulp and milk, initially which would be test marketedfor two months in Kolkata before national launch. 

It is Coca-Cola’s 3rd fruit-based beverage product after Minute Maid Pulpy Orange and Minute Maid Nimbu Fresh.


Bytes:-
Coca-Cola has milk-based products like Nutiboost in China.

The World's first 3D camera

Fujilfilm's camera takes two photos simultaneously from its two lenses which are fixed a similar distance apart to human eyes.

Using 'lenticular' technology, the separate left and right eye images are interlaced on a furrowed surface to create the stereoscopic illusion.

The method has been around since the 1940s and was typically used on novelty items and stickers, featuring simple two-frame animations such as a winking eye.

However, the old technology is now being used in a wave of state-of-the-art 3D products, games consoles and billboard posters.

Interpret the world

Ogilvy & Mather Mumbai created this series of billboard ads for The Economist to make people "interpret the world" so to speak.

Each billboard bore three seemingly unrelated visuals placed within each other, which together told a set of inter-related, globally relevant stories.
